Ceisteanna—Questions. Oral Answers. - County Galway School.

49.

asked the Minister for Finance when the work of providing an addition to Dunmore national school, County Galway, will commence.

The drawings and specification for the extension of this school are nearing completion and tenders for the work will be invited within the next few months.

Would the Minister not agree there was undue delay in providing this extension to Dunmore national school?

No. There was some small delay regarding ensuring that there would be an adequate water supply for it.

When will the work be carried out?

We hope to invite tenders in the next few months.

It was the parish priest who contacted me about this matter. Is the Minister aware of the dissatisfaction among the teachers in the school at the lack of room in the school at the moment due to the fact that the Office of Public Works have not carried out this work? There is undue delay here regardless of what the Parliamentary Secretary says. I am quite sure the Parliamentary Secretary is not even aware of the problem.

I certainly was not aware that the parish priest contacted the Deputy. A grant was sanctioned in January, 1969. The only delay in the matter was in regard to the provision of an adequate water supply.
